My life embodied with ‘restraint, labour and simplicity is my message. I live life which is full of restraint. My aim is to reach to the top of restraint. I want to make some specific experiments in this direction. I wish to live life encompassed with work. So long as live, I should labour—this is my aspiration. Simplicity is the ornament of restraint. I obtain the assisting mode to live a simple and healthy life by this.

I dislike appreciation. If the feeling of favourable likelihood is clubbed with it, it may not be beneficial. It will fulfil no purpose.

Do not torture any creature. Do not harass anyone. Do not restrain. Labour and simplicity are those elements which are key to excellence for mine. It benefits others also. The element, beneficial to all, should be valued.

The world is terrified with problems. In my opinion the absence of restraint, labour and simplicity are the basic causes of most of the problems. If public life is inspired by the idea of restraint, labour and simplicity, many problems may be sorted out automatically.

I have inherited these pure practices. I have learnt to live such life from respectable Gurudev Kalugani. I had not to go to any college or university for learning this process. This is Indian culture. It is the culture of spirituality, Jain religion and Terapanth. It is indeed a blessing to Terapanth. Self-discipline is flourished by restraint. Labour activates our self and simplicity links the person with reality. I desire that these pure practices should be consolidated in ‘Dharmasangh’. In this angle, life of Acharya Bhikshu is an ideal life. It is essential that this ideal should inspire at every step.

I have spent Seventy-seven years of my life peacefully and actively. Today I am crossing the age limit of Acharya Bhikshu, the founder of Terapanth and entering into the age limit of Shri Maghwacharya. Among the Acharya of Terapanth, the creativity of Acharya Bhikshu and Jayacharya was unpatrolled. Their contribution in the glaring glory of Terapanth is fantastic. What I have done, what I am doing and shall be doing, is the positive outcome of the kindness of ex-acharyas. I cannot forget their benefaction even in dreams.

Dedication, discipline and unification of Terapanth Dharmasangh are famous. I am overwhelmed with the respect and dedicative attitude that inherited from Dharmasangh during my tenure. It has determined my goal of consciousness towards any indication or view of mine. This consciousness has tremendous contribution in my success.

On the eve of New Year, I am receiving good wishes and compliments from Dharmasangh. After acknowledging all these expressions, I pledge to stay in conformity with the aspirations of Dharmasangh. Dharmasangh should also understand my desires and assist me fully to fulfil the same. Once again I reiterate the resolution to hold myself dedicated for the service of mankind along with the entire Dharma Parivar. I trust that this joyous feeling of service and dedication will have the flavour of rejoice during whole year.
